Silver Shoes is a 2015 explicit, award-winning erotic art trilogy produced by Blue Artichoke Films in Amsterdam. Directed by Jennifer Lyon Bell, the film successfully bridged the gap between independent art-house cinema and explicit adult media, winning "Movie of the Year" at the Feminist Porn Awards in Toronto.
